The Monastery of Echoing Swords

The ancient temple of the Monastery of Echoing Swords stood on the edge of a cliff, overlooking a sea of time. The air was thick with the scent of pine and the whispers of the past. YellowHair, a monk with an unyielding spirit and a heart as vast as the sky, had set out on a pilgrimage that would change the course of history.

The story began on a serene morning when YellowHair awoke to the sound of his own name being called. The voice was faint but clear, as if carried on the wind from a distant place. He followed the sound, stepping through a portal that appeared in the temple garden. The portal led to a bustling marketplace in ancient China, the year 1350.

YellowHair's first encounter in this time was with a young swordsman named Li, who was being chased by a band of bandits. The monk stepped in without hesitation, using his martial arts skills to defend the swordsman. The battle was fierce, but YellowHair's mastery of the ancient martial arts was unmatched. The bandits were no match for the monk's agility and strength, and they fled in disarray.

Li, grateful for YellowHair's help, invited the monk to his home, where he learned that the bandits were searching for an ancient scroll that held the secrets to time travel. Li believed that the scroll was in the hands of the evil warlord, Zhang, who sought to use its power to control the past, present, and future.

YellowHair, driven by his desire for enlightenment and the knowledge that the scroll's power could be used for good or evil, decided to embark on a quest to retrieve the scroll. His journey took him through the bustling streets of the ancient city, into the treacherous wilderness, and through the portals of time itself.

As YellowHair delved deeper into his quest, he discovered that the scroll was not a mere artifact of power but a piece of a much larger puzzle. The true nature of time and the fabric of the universe was revealed to him, and he learned that the scroll was a key to unlocking the secrets of the cosmos.

In his quest, YellowHair encountered many challenges, including betrayal from those he trusted, the temptation of power, and the moral dilemmas that came with wielding such immense authority. He fought alongside heroes and villains alike, each battle teaching him something new about the nature of his own existence.

The climax of the story occurred when YellowHair confronted Zhang in the heart of the Monastery of Echoing Swords. Zhang, a cunning and ruthless warlord, had already used the scroll to travel through time, but YellowHair's knowledge of the universe's secrets gave him the upper hand. The battle was intense, with both men pushing each other to the brink of their limits.

In the end, YellowHair managed to defeat Zhang, using his martial arts skills and the wisdom he had gained from his journey. However, the scroll's power was too great for any one person to control, and YellowHair knew that it must be destroyed. He shattered the scroll with a single, powerful strike, sending its fragments into the wind.

With the scroll destroyed, the fabric of time began to unravel, threatening to erase the entire universe. YellowHair, with his heart full of sorrow but his spirit unbroken, stepped into the portal once more, this time to return to his own time.

The story concluded with YellowHair returning to the Monastery of Echoing Swords, where he found that his journey had not only saved the universe but had also changed him forever. He realized that true enlightenment was not about mastering the world around him, but about understanding the nature of his own existence and the infinite possibilities of time.

In the end, YellowHair's pilgrimage through time had not only been a quest for power but a journey of self-discovery. He had learned that the greatest strength lies in the heart, and that the true path to enlightenment was through compassion and understanding.
